By The Jasper Sea

Author: W. G. Burnham; Aldine S. Kieffer Hymnal: The Cyber Hymnal #13596 First Line: I love to think of that happy land Lyrics: 1 I love to think of that happy land, By the jasper sea; Where the eye shall never be dimmed by tears, And the smiling face of Jesus appears; For death may not sever the household band, When they all gather there on the golden strand, By the jasper sea, by the jasper sea. 2 I love to talk of that happy land, By the jasper sea; For there is no trouble, or pain or sin, Where the white robed angels welcome us in; To all that is beautiful, calm and bright, O’er the river of death, thro’ the gates of light, By the jasper sea, by the jasper sea. 3 I love to think of that happy land, By the jasper sea; For the Savior dwells on its blissful shore; And His blood-bought ones shall sorrow no more, For endless and sure shall His bright reign be On the throne of His love by the jasper sea, By the jasper sea, by the jasper sea. Languages: English Tune Title: [I love to think of that happy land]
